NIAGARA FALLS, NY — Niagara Falls Memorial Medical Center (NFMMC) is pleased to announce the appointment of Lori Wolfe as its Director of Quality & Compliance. In her new role, Wolfe will be pivotal in overseeing and enhancing the quality of care provided to Memorial patients.
Prior to joining NFMMC, Wolfe served as a Registered Nurse at University Hospital in Columbia, MO, specializing in Surgical Specialties and Trauma ICU. During her tenure at the University Hospital, Lori demonstrated exceptional leadership skills as a co-chair on the Shared Leadership Governing Board.
Wolfe’s career encompasses a diverse range of responsibilities, including serving as the Executive Director of the Coalition Against Rape & Domestic Violence and the Program Director in the Wound Center at the Moberly Regional Medical Center & Accelerate Wound Centers.
Wolfe holds a Missouri State Registered Nurse license, and her academic achievements include a Bachelor of Science in Nursing from the University of Missouri, a Master of Health Administration, and a Master of Geriatric Health Management from A.T. Still University. Additionally, she earned a Master of Business Administration from William Woods University.
ABOUT NIAGARA FALLS MEMORIAL MEDICAL CENTER
Founded in 1895, Niagara Falls Memorial Medical Center (NFMMC) has a long tradition of serving the Niagara community. NFMMC’s hospital and primary stroke program are accredited by the Accreditation Commission for Health Care, and its primary care network is accredited by the National Committee for Quality Assurance. Memorial’s inpatient services include a cardiac/stroke unit, a medical–surgical unit, an ICU, a Labor and Delivery unit, and an Adult Inpatient Psychiatry unit, the only one of its kind in Niagara County. Memorial serves as a Center for Community Health by operating five primary care centers, a large outpatient adult mental health clinic, a Health Home, and several innovative community-based services. Thanks to a partnership with Catholic Health, Kaleida Health, and Erie County Medical Center, NFMMC operates the only cardiac catheterization laboratory in Niagara County. Memorial is also home to the Golisano Medical Oncology Center, which operates in collaboration with Roswell Park Comprehensive Care Center.
